Передача класса this

176
27 декабря 2017, 18:11

Пытаюсь передать this (или саму форму по названию) в другой класс по событию CreateDatabase_Load или CreateDatabase_Shown

из

private void CreateDatabase_Shown(object sender, EventArgs e)
{
    Main.ChangeLanguage.CreateDatabaseSQL(this);
}

передаю в

public static void CreateDatabaseSQL(SQL.CreateDatabase component)
{
    component.groupBox1.Text = "4";
}

Но при работе с любым компонентом к примеру component.groupBox1.Text выдает ошибку в Windows 8.1

Object reference not set to an instance of an object

Смешно что на Windows 7 или XP все работает а вот в Windows 8.1 нет, как обойти ошибку?

READ ALSO
Парсинг HTML и разбор script по полочкам

Парсинг HTML и разбор script по полочкам

Если спарсил HTML код и в нём есть что подобное:

215
С# назначить кнопку через ComboBox для элемента

С# назначить кнопку через ComboBox для элемента

Здравствуйте, кто может подсказать и показать примерами как бы в роде простую задачку?

200
Task скачивания файла

Task скачивания файла

Запутался в одном вопросе, просьба знающих помочьПри открытии формы проверяю, существует ли на жёстком диске файл

204
c# [DllImport] в методе, функция из dll без обьявления

c# [DllImport] в методе, функция из dll без обьявления

Можно ли как-то в c# в самом методе подключить функцию из dll ? То есть, подобную конструкцию засунуть в метод (например метод Main):

189